Essential Steps to Become a Certified Medical‌ Assistant

1. Meet Basic Education Requirements

Most aspiring medical assistants should⁤ have at least a high‌ school diploma or‌ equivalent (GED). This is ⁢the foundational ⁣step before⁢ pursuing formal training.

2. Enroll in an​ Accredited Medical Assistant Program

Choose a reputable program that meets‍ accreditation standards from bodies like ⁤the Commission on‍ Accreditation of Allied Health Education‍ programs (CAAHEP) or the Accrediting Bureau⁤ of Health‍ Education Schools (ABHES). These ‌programs​ typically last 9 ⁤months to 2 years and cover essential topics ⁢such⁣ as anatomy, physiology, medical terminology, clinical procedures, and‍ pharmacology.

4. Prepare and Pass⁤ the Certified Medical Assistant Exam

The Certified Medical Assistant ⁤(CMA) ‍exam is administered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A) ⁢or​ the American Association of ⁣Medical ⁢Assistants (AAMA) depending ​on the ​certification chosen. Planning tips include:

  • Review your training materials thoroughly
  • Utilize online practice⁤ exams
  • Attend prep courses if necessary

5. Obtain Your Certification

Once⁣ you pass the exam, you’ll receive ⁣your CMA credential, which is valid for 5 years.⁣ Maintaining certification often requires continuing education units (CEUs).

6.Pursue continuing Education &‍ Certification Renewal

stay ⁣current in the field by earning ceus and renewing your certification on time to retain your credential⁢ and remain competitive ‍in the⁣ job market.

Benefits of Becoming a‍ Certified ‍Medical ⁢Assistant & Career Outlook

Certification not only validates your⁤ skills but⁤ also ‌enhances your job prospects.According to the Bureau of Labor ​Statistics, medical assistant employment ‍is projected to grow 19% from 2021 to​ 2031, much faster than the average for all occupations. This growth reflects the increasing ‍demand for outpatient care and administrative‌ support ⁤in healthcare.
